Confirmation Agent information

What is a confirmation agent?

Confirmation Agents are professionals responsible for verifying, validating, and confirming information related to transactions, bookings, or other business activities. They often work in industries such as finance, travel, or logistics, ensuring that all details are accurate and meet company or regulatory standards. Their role may involve communicating with clients, partners, or internal teams to cross-check data and resolve discrepancies. Strong attention to detail, organizational skills, and excellent communication are essential for this position.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a confirmation agent?

To thrive as a Confirmation Agent, you need strong attention to detail, excellent communication skills, and a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with customer relationship management (CRM) systems, call center software, and office productivity tools is typically required. Exceptional interpersonal skills, patience, and the ability to remain organized under pressure help individuals stand out in this position. These skills ensure accurate information verification, effective customer interactions, and smooth workflow in a fast-paced environment.

What are the most common challenges faced by confirmation agents, and how can they effectively handle them?

Confirmation Agents often face challenges such as managing high call volumes, handling difficult or unresponsive clients, and ensuring accurate data entry under time constraints. To overcome these, it's important to develop strong communication and organizational skills, remain calm and professional during interactions, and utilize available CRM tools to track confirmations efficiently. Regular collaboration with team members and supervisors can also help resolve issues quickly and maintain a smooth workflow.

Here is what you will be doing each day:

As a Front Desk Agent, you would be responsible for greeting and registering guests and checking guests out of the hotel in the hotel's continuing effort to deliver outstanding guest service and financial profitability. Specifically, you would be responsible for performing the following tasks to the highest standards:

  • Greet guests and complete the registration process to include, but not limited to, inputting and retrieving information from the computer, confirmation of guest information and room rate, selection of rooms, coding electronic keys, promoting marketing programs, providing a welcome packet and ensuring guest knows location of room and/or has a bell person accompany him/her
  • Assist guests with check-out including, but not limited to, ensuring rooms and services are correctly accounted, using the point-of-sale system, handling money, processing credit and debit cards, accepting and recording various forms of payment, converting foreign currency, making change and processing gift certificates and cards
  • Demonstrate a thorough knowledge of hotel information including, but not limited to, room categories, room rates, packages, promotions, the local area and other general product knowledge and answer guest questions and inquiries
  • Use up-selling techniques to promote hotel services and facilities and to maximize room occupancy
  • Respond to guest inquiries and requests and resolve issues in a timely, friendly and efficient manner
  • Field guest complaints, conduct research and resolve and negotiate solutions for guest satisfaction
  • Receive, input, retrieve and relay messages to guests
